Organization: Shelburne Long Term Care

Description of Services: 58-bed long-term care home * residential care for 1 private bed, 26 semi-private beds, and 31 basic beds * 24-hour nursing and personal care * access to a doctor and other health professionals * non smoking
  • bedding and furniture
  • laundry and housekeeping
  • meals
  • personal hygiene supplies
  • medical supplies and equipment (such as catheters, ostomy bags, or wound care supplies)
  • assistance with medication and activities of daily living
  • recreation and social programs

Additional services and facilities:
  • dental care
  • foot care
  • hair dressing
  • pastoral care
  • physiotherapy

Fees: Rates set by the Ontario Ministry of Long-Term Care * subsidies for basic rates may be available for eligible applicants
Eligibility - Population(s) Served: Adults who need long-term care * care coordinators assess the needs of applicants
Application: Contact Ontario Health atHome-Brampton
Out-of-region applicants must apply through the Ontario Health atHome office in the region where they reside
